How do you add data labels to certain points?
Method — add one data label to a chart line
- Click on the chart line to add the data point to.
- All the data points will be highlighted.
- Click again on the single point that you want to add a data label to.
- Right-click and select ‘Add data label’
- This is the key step!
How do I label data points in Excel?
To label one data point, after clicking the series, click that data point. > Data Labels. To change the location, click the arrow, and choose an option. If you want to show your data label inside a text bubble shape, click Data Callout.

How do I add lines to data labels in Excel?
Add a Leader Line
Step 1 − Click on the data label. Step 2 − Drag it after you see the four-headed arrow. Step 3 − Move the data label. The Leader Line automatically adjusts and follows it.
How do I add data labels in Excel 2016?
To add data labels in Excel 2013 or Excel 2016, follow these steps:
- Activate the chart by clicking on it, if necessary.
- Make sure the Design tab of the ribbon is displayed.
- Click the Add Chart Element drop-down list.
- Select the Data Labels tool.
- Select the position that best fits where you want your labels to appear.

How do I add an intersection point in Excel?
Click on the trend line, right click, then choose format trend line. Now choose the option “Display equation in chart”. Once you have both equations displayed, equate them( you will have to write this out if you don’t use some other tool) and obtain your point of intersection.

Where is data range in Excel?
Press [F5]. In the Go To dialog, click the Special button in the bottom-left corner. In the resulting dialog, click the Current Region option. Click OK, and Excel will select the current data range (the current region).
What is a data point in Excel?
Data Point: A single value located in a worksheet cell plotted in a chart or graph. Data Marker: A column, dot, pie slice, or another symbol in the chart representing a data value.
How do you edit data labels in Excel?
Edit the contents of a title or data label that is linked to data on the worksheet
- In the worksheet, click the cell that contains the title or data label text that you want to change.
- Edit the existing contents, or type the new text or value, and then press ENTER. The changes you made automatically appear on the chart.

How do you add last data label in Excel?
Select just the single point you want a label on: click once to select the series, then click again to select one point. Now when you use the right-click menu or the plus sign icon to add data labels, it will add a label only on the one point you’ve selected.

How do I find the intersection of data in Excel?
Intersect Operator in Excel can be used to find the intersecting value(s) of two lists/ranges. This an unusual operator as it is represented by a space character (yes that’s right). If you use a space character in between two ranges, then it becomes the Intersect operator in Excel.
What is intercept function in Excel?
The INTERCEPT function returns the point at which a line will intersect the y-axis based on known x and y values.A regression line is a line that best fits that known data points. Use the INTERCEPT function to calculate the value of a dependent variable when the independent variable is zero (0).
How do I select all data in a cell in Excel?
Click the Select All button. Press CTRL+A. Note If the worksheet contains data, and the active cell is above or to the right of the data, pressing CTRL+A selects the current region. Pressing CTRL+A a second time selects the entire worksheet.
